Glass Fiber Reinforced Concrete (GFRC) is a high-performance composite material that combines cement-based matrices with alkali-resistant glass fibers to significantly enhance structural properties. Unlike traditional concrete, which is strong in compression but weak in tension, GFRC improves tensile strength, crack resistance, and overall durability.
The addition of glass fibers acts as micro-reinforcement within the concrete matrix. These fibers distribute stresses more evenly and prevent crack propagation under mechanical loading. As a result, GFRC structures exhibit improved toughness and impact resistance compared to conventional concrete.
One of the most attractive features of GFRC is its lightweight nature. Because glass fibers provide reinforcement, thinner sections can be produced without compromising strength. This reduces overall structural weight, making GFRC ideal for architectural facades, cladding panels, decorative elements, and complex shapes.
Durability is another key advantage. Alkali-resistant glass fibers are specifically designed to withstand the highly alkaline cement environment, ensuring long-term performance. GFRC also offers improved resistance to weathering, corrosion, and freeze-thaw cycles.
From a sustainability perspective, reduced material usage and lighter structures contribute to lower transportation and installation energy costs. Additionally, GFRC allows innovative architectural designs that were previously difficult or expensive to achieve with traditional reinforced concrete.
As construction technologies evolve, GFRC continues to gain popularity in infrastructure, commercial buildings, and artistic architectural applications. By combining strength, flexibility, and design freedom, glass fiber concrete represents a significant advancement in modern construction materials.
